Dr. Corinne Hohl is an expert in Adverse Drug events and is building system solutions to more easily document and share that information and ultimately reduce the incidence of these events. She’s recently been published in a commentary addressing Vanessa’s Law, a new bill requiring greater reporting of adverse drug events by healthcare institutions.

This weekend, residents, nurses, and physicians from the VGH emergency department and UBC participated in the 8th annual Brenna Innes Memorial Soccer Tournament to benefit the BC Burn Fund. The tournament raised over $11 000 this year.
